Manoir de Bélyvière
The Manoir de Bélyvière is situated on Chemin de Belyvières in Le Controis-en-Sologne, France.
History
- Construction of the castle began in the 16th century (C16). It was built as a fortified manor house. The site has been designated as a Monument Historique (MHS) since 1948.
